Nestled in an old Victorian house on Greenwood Avenue, Molten Java is more than just a coffee shop; it's a cozy haven that exudes warmth and community spirit. Patrons rave about the exceptional coffee, from the unique Dirty Joe, infused with caramel, to the indulgent Super Joe, blending chocolate and espresso. The extensive tea selection, including flavorful options like Blueberry Green and Chai Spice, complements the robust coffee offerings. Customers, like Pete Celona, appreciate the welcoming atmosphere created by Wendy and her team, highlighting the delicious food and snacks available. The diverse menu features everything from breakfast sandwiches to sweet treats, appealing to all taste buds. Arja Reels describes it as a charming café that makes even children feel at home, with kid-friendly toys enhancing the experience. The inviting environment encourages guests to linger, enjoying board games and browsing quirky items for sale while sipping their favorite brew. Regulars like Jennifer Saipher feel a deep connection to the space, repeatedly returning for the quality drinks and good food. Overall, Molten Java stands out as a delightful spot for coffee lovers and casual diners alike, making it a must-visit destination in Bethel, CT.
